Egor Bondarev is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Aerospace Engineering and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Egor Bondarev has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 187 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 8 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 8 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Egor Bondarev’s work include Video Surveillance and Tracking Methods (9 papers),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(8 papers) and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(8 papers). Egor Bondarev is often cited by papers focused on Video Surveillance and Tracking Methods (9 papers),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(8 papers) and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(8 papers). Egor Bondarev coll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ands, Ireland and France. Egor Bondarev's co-authors include Peter H. N. de With, John McDonald, Timothy J. Whelan, Michel R. V. Chaudron, Svitlana Zinger, Lingni Ma, Arash Pourtaherian, Heorhiy Byelas, Thomas J. Whelan and Bas Boom and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Geoscience and Remote Sensing, Sensors and Remote Sensing.
